SC16C750BIB64 by NXP Semiconductors

SC16C750BIB64 by NXP Semiconductors is a Serial Communication Controller with 64 terminals, operating at 48 MHz clock frequency. It supports data transfer rate of 0.375 MBps and has low power mode for industrial applications.

Manufacturer Highlights

NXP Semiconductors

NXP is a leading semiconductor company that creates cutting-edge technology to power secure connections in a smarter world. Founded in 2006, they have grown to become one of the top five global semiconductor companies and serve their customers in over 70 countries around the world.
